Question: The expression $ 2\cos \frac{\pi }{13}.\cos \frac{9\pi }{13}+\cos \frac{3\pi }{13}+\cos \frac{5\pi }{13} $ is equal to

[UPSEAT 2004]

Options:

A) -1

B) 0

C) 1

D) None of these

Show Answer

Answer:

Correct Answer: B

Solution:

$ 2\cos \frac{\pi }{13}.\cos \frac{9\pi }{13}+\cos \frac{3\pi }{13}+\cos \frac{5\pi }{13} $ $ =2\cos \frac{\pi }{13}.\cos \frac{9\pi }{13}+2\cos \frac{4\pi }{13}\cos \frac{\pi }{13} $ $ =2\cos \frac{\pi }{13}[ \cos \frac{9\pi }{13}+\cos \frac{4\pi }{13} ] $ $ =2\cos \frac{\pi }{13}[ 2\cos \frac{\pi }{2}.\cos \frac{5\pi }{26} ]=0 $ , $ [ \because \cos \frac{\pi }{2}=0 ] $ .
